A kind of biomembrane sewage cycling treatment device
Technical field
The utility model relates to water treatment field more particularly to a kind of biomembrane sewage cycling treatment devices.
Background technique
The means of sewage treatment have very much, commonly such as gravitational settling, sedimentation basin, activated sludge process, biofilm, change The precipitation method, oxidation-reduction method, absorption method etc. are learned, existing biomembrane sewage treatment takes up a large area, often a processing Equipment needs to take up an area tens of squares, and needs to consume a large amount of electric power.

Utility model works principle: the utility model sewage-treatment plant when specifically used, sewage is led to first It crosses sewage water inlet pipe and pours into sewage-treatment plant body interior, a certain amount of rear closing water inlet pipe gate, internal sewage is being added Solid and the large particle that can not be decomposed can be filtered out under the filtering of strainer, liquid can flow into clean water tank, in clean water tank Biological filter membrane sewage can repeatedly be purified, water can be transported to water purification groove top by water pump after flowing into water purification trench bottom again Portion, until can open outlet pipe gate after sewage thoroughly purifies, purified water is flowed out of the water outlet pipe, then sewage into Water pipe just can enter next group sewage.
